转载:https://www.csdn.net/gather_23/NtDaIg1sMDYtYmxvZwO0O0OO0O0O.html

Windows平台代码如下:

 #include <windows.h>

 //string to char*
/*
string path;
const char* tempPath = path.c_str();
*/ WIN32_FIND_DATAA FindFileData;
FindFirstFileA("c:\\1.txt",&FindFileData);
//FindFirstFileA(tempPath,&FindFileData);
if(FindFileData.dwFileAttributes & FILE_ATTRIBUTE_DIRECTORY)
{
//Folder
}
else
{
//File
}

最新文章

  1. python mysql操作
  2. 安卓 io流 写入文件,再读取的基本使用
  3. Java IO读取文件之二
  4. hosts文件的作用 whois查询域名信息
  5. DHCP Option 60 的理解
  6. js使用正则表达式去空格
  7. Android开发之sharedpreferences 详解
  8. 执行计划之CONCATENATION
  9. uva 1510 - Neon Sign(计数)
  10. ASP.NET MVC 中 View 的设计
  11. char在C语言一个字节表示的数据范围
  12. Mybatis面试集合(转)
  13. Log4Net在MVC下的配置以及运用线程队列记录异常信息
  14. 关于box-shadow和drop-shadow的显著区别
  15. What is the name of the “--&amp;gt;” operator?(Stackoverflow)
  16. 移除元素(remove,remove_if...unique...)
  17. shell 脚本启动spring boot的jar 包
  18. Windows下安装mysql cluster
  19. C# 文件操作系列一
  20. Spring Cloud(五):熔断监控Hystrix Dashboard和Turbine

热门文章

  1. 第五节: 前后端交互之Promise用法和Fetch用法
  2. idea选中文件时左侧菜单自动定位到文件所在位置
  3. 五分钟学Java:打印Java数组最优雅的方式是什么?
  4. 数据库持久化框架——MyBatis(1)
  5. Fluent_Python_Part1序幕,01-data-model, 数据模型
  6. 一些封装的php函数
  7. CSS制作二级菜单时,二级菜单与一级菜单不对齐
  8. 「JSOI2013」旅行时的困惑
  9. Bugku-CTF社工篇之简单的个人信息收集
  10. PyQt5窗口操作大全